Responsibilities

  • Triage incoming requests to the Help Desk via telephone, web portal, or email to ensure courteous, timely, and effective resolution of end-user issues
  • Prioritize incidents and service requests to meet department-defined service-level agreements
  • Troubleshoot and resolve (or in rare circumstances escalate) Windows® and Microsoft® Office issues to senior team members
  • Troubleshoot and resolve or escalate standard company software applications (e.g., Microsoft Teams, Zoom, Adobe Suite, web browsers)
  • Troubleshoot and resolve or escalate VOIP phone issues
  • Manage end-to-end onboarding and offboarding of user accounts and/or devices
  • Complete server-level access tasks as assigned by senior team members
  • Serve as an escalation point for Level I tickets, reviewing and resolving issues that exceed L1 scope before escalating to senior team members
  • Manage and maintain user accounts and permissions in Active Directory, including group memberships, access rights, and password policies
  • Support endpoint security and patch management, ensuring devices remain up to date and compliant with company standards
  • Maintain and contribute to the IT knowledge base, documenting resolutions and procedures to improve team efficiency
  • Assist with hardware asset management, tracking inventory, coordinating equipment procurement, and managing device lifecycle
  • Meet or exceed all company security standards
